Just how to Pick a Tent Footprint
Whether you need a camping tent impact depends upon where and exactly how usually you will be camping. The footprints offered by the producer of your camping tent are normally a great option however they can be pricey and hefty (the NEMO Hornet Dragonfly 2P impact considers 6.9 oz).

Size
A tent footprint is essentially a sheet that goes under your tent. It protects the ground underneath your outdoor tents from unpleasant things, and it maintains all-time low of your camping tent clean and dry. It additionally lowers the quantity of warmth shed to the ground while you rest, and it can assist secure your camping tent from wetness.
The best tent footprints are sized precisely to match the flooring area of your camping tent. They are typically made of a durable, water-proof product like polyurethane or nylon. Nguyen advises selecting a footprint with a denier score of 250 or higher for maximum durability.
Several exterior gear business market their very own top quality tent impacts that are made to fit effortlessly with the matching camping tent. However, these can be quite costly and contribute to the overall weight of your backpacking setup. For these factors, we normally suggest using a do it yourself choice instead.
Material
An outdoor tents impact keeps the floor of your sanctuary clean, especially if you are camping in locations with a great deal of rain. It can additionally aid stop water from pooling up underneath your outdoor tents which might leak right into the camping tent itself.
The material used in an outdoor tents impact differs, however the most usual is an easy-to-clean and long lasting polyurethane or polyester fabric. Some come with a sack to divide them from your gear when not in use.
Some backpackers pick to make their own DIY impacts out of Tyvek home wrap or Polycryo window insulation reduce film. This is typically a less costly and lighter alternative than acquiring a manufacturer details one. It is very important to note, nonetheless, that a do it yourself footprint will certainly not safeguard against slits or abrasions in addition to a top quality camping tent flooring. If you are making use of a homemade footprint, make certain to roll up the edges so it doesn't gather water. If you're stressed over this, consider updating to a more strong option like the ones made by suppliers.

Weight
A camping tent impact is a thin sheet of polyurethane, nylon or polyester that rests between your shelter and the ground when outdoor camping. It's designed to secure your tent from rough components like jagged rocks, twigs and abrasive surface areas, discusses Elizabeth Nguyen, an elderly sales professional at REI in Atlanta.
Nguyen states most exterior gear producers supply their own top quality outdoor tents footprints that are created to fit flawlessly with their designated camping tents, adding assurance and comfort. But these branded impacts often tend to be thicker and heavier than DIY alternatives that are readily available on the market, so they deserve a more detailed look when shopping around.
If you're on a budget plan or are focusing on weight, it's easy to make your own camping tent impact making use of easy materials that can be located at most equipment or do it yourself stores. This choice is popular among ultralight backpackers and long-distance walkers to save money and preserve weight where feasible. It's also worth keeping in mind that the majority of tents are now made with a sewn-in groundsheet, so a tent footprint may be unneeded in these instances.
